Located on the banks of the Panchaganga River in Maharashtra, Kolhapur is well-known for gorgeous temples, traditional leather sandals aka Kolhapuri chappals, beautiful necklaces and unique spices. Once a princely state, this quaint city boasts rich legacy that goes back to the time of Marathas. The majestic Mahalakshmi Temple, which is one of the most revered religious spots, is situated in this city and attracts people from far and wide. Tourist attractions in Kolhapur
Some of the most amazing tourist attractions in the city are Mahalaxmi Temple, Rankala Lake, Maharaja’s Palace, Chhatrapati Shahu Museum, Panhala Fort and Jyotiba Temple.
Places to shop in Kolhapur
A paradise for all shopaholics, Kolhapur is renowned for footwear, and intricate jewellery known as saaj. Some of the best spots where you can shop till you drop are Bahusinghji Road, Shahupuri Market, Vinayak Mall, DYP City Mall and V R Plaza Chowk.
Best time to visit Kolhapur
November to February is the best time to visit the city as the weather during this time is perfect for indulging in sightseeing and outdoor activities.

Weather in Kolhapur
The winter season in Kolhapur, i.e. from November to February, is quite pleasant, while summers (between March and June) are quite hot and humid. During monsoons, i.e. between July and September, the city witnesses abundant rainfall owing to its proximity to the Western Ghats.
Airport in Kolhapur
Kolhapur Airport (IATA: KLH) connects the city with other parts of India.
